#c56dea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c56dea is composed of 77.3% red, 42.7%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.8%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 282.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 67.3%. #c56dea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daff with #8b00d5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#c56dea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c56dea has RGB values of R:197, G:109,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 12938730.

Hex triplet c56dea #c56dea
RGB Decimal 197, 109, 234 rgb(197,109,234)
RGB Percent 77.3, 42.7, 91.8 rgb(77.3%,42.7%,91.8%)
CMYK 16, 53, 0, 8
HSL 282.2°, 74.9, 67.3 hsl(282.2,74.9%,67.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 282.2°, 53.4, 91.8
Web Safe cc66ff #cc66ff
CIE-LAB 60.56, 54.858, -49.297
XYZ 43.344, 28.749, 81.103
xyY 0.283, 0.188, 28.749
CIE-LCH 60.56, 73.754, 318.056
CIE-LUV 60.56, 34.377, -84.959
Hunter-Lab 53.618, 50.463, -52.149
Binary 11000101, 01101101, 11101010

Shades and Tints of #c56dea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060108 is the darkest color, while #fcf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c56dea

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ada7b0 is the less saturated color, while #cd5afd is the most saturated one.
